In Blackeberg an apartment costs on average 51 000 kr per square metre, about 23% less than in Stockholm.

Part of Hässelby-Vällingby

Condition, floor, layout and renovations move the price a long way in both directions. A span is the honest answer area data can give.

The square-metre price for apartments is debt-adjusted where the association's loan is known, so the figure sits close to the home's total value. Your share of that loan comes off when you sell.

Around 8 909 people live here, with a median income of 294 000 kr a year. In the 2022 general election Social Democrats was the largest party with 33% of the vote, and Moderates got a lower share than in Stockholm.

Source: Statistics Sweden & the Swedish Election Authority
